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7281642790 6108 44490
70966 62854734
70966 62854734
24840248351 3634948 397308430
All about undefined
Interested in learning more?
70966 62854734
24840248351 3634948 397308430
See more
3174 4527895927 91548660957
601 09 29 8737805
See more
02785503 0907
059 3584206 257049 401 51978919441
See more